Presentation Title | Date | Page 3 The Challenge Data Services ¬Easy to implement, easy to reuse ¬E.g. retrieving customer data from a single database Infrastructure Services ¬Challenging to implement, easy to reuse ¬E.g. coordinating a business process across multiple systems Decision Services ¬Hard to implement, complex to reuse, expensive to maintain ¬E.g. credit scoring, pricing, eligibility, up-sell, discounting…

Presentation Title | Date | Page 4 Understanding Transparent Decision Services? Business rules are expressed in a form accessible to their business stakeholders. Tracability from the decision service to the business rules. Service-oriented interface to a high- level business decision. Metric and reporting to drive reuse decisions.
5
Presentation Title | Date | Page 5 Transparent Rules are statements of business policy accessible to business owners ¬Not cryptic code! ¬Largely self-documenting ¬Reusable

Presentation Title | Date | Page 7 Transparent Decision Service Lifecycle 1.Define Transparent Decision Services signature (architect) 2.Implement business rules (business analyst or policy manager) 3.Deploy RuleApp (developer or business analyst) 4.RuleApp exposed as Web Service (administrator) 5.Publish Web Service definition to CentraSite (architect) 6.Publish service metadata to CentraSite (architect) 7.Query CentraSite Repository (architect 2 ) 8.Reuse Transparent Decision Service (architect 2 )

Presentation Title | Date | Page 10 Technical Alignment: ILOG JRules and CentraSite 1.Architectural: JMX, Eclipse, Tomcat/J2EE, BIRT, repository 2.Core capabilities within JRules 1.Eclipse-based tools to model and implement rule-based services 2.Web Services without developer intervention or code deployment 3.Tracability from deployed rules to the business rules repository 4.Business rules reports for publication to CentraSite repository 5.Runtime statistics on usage of Transparent Decision Services 6.APIs to publish deployed service metadata to CentraSite
